The Pattonville High School varsity girls soccer team will host a "Kicks For Cancer" soccer game at 4 p.m., Thursday, April 21 at Pattonville High School. Β
All money raised will benefit the David C. Pratt Cancer Center at St. John's Mercy Hospital.Β Admission to the event is $2, and T-shirts are available for $10.
Players will also sell raffle tickets for more than 20 different prizes, including Walt Disney World day passes, an autographed mini St. Louis Rams helmet, Jewish Community Center family membership and restaurant gift cards. Β

Team members will be playing the game against in honor of loved ones battling cancer. These loved ones will be honored at the game half-time.
